    Airframe Family: Vought A-7 Corsair II
    Latest Model:A-7D-8-CV Corsair II
    Last Military Serial:70-1004 USAF
    Construction Number:D-150
    Latest Owner or Location:National, Kolb Road, Tucson, AZ

    Dates

    Event

    Constructed as an A-7D-8-CV by Vought at Dallas, Texas, USA.

    Circa 1970

    Taken on Strength/Charge with the United States Air Force with s/n 70-1004.

    From Circa 1970 to December 1970

    Transferred to 355th Tactical Fighter Wing, Takhli Royal Thai Air Force Base, Thailand.

    July 1971

    Base of operations changed.
    Davis-Monthan AFB, AZ.

    By 1974

    Transferred to 356th Tactical Fighter Squadron/354th Tactical Fighter WIng, Myrtle Beach AFB, SC.

    January 1978

    Transferred to 162nd Tactical Fighter Squadron (ANG)/178th Tactical FIghter Group, Springfield, OH.
    Operated with markings: Ohio

    June 1978


    Photographer: Glenn Chatfield

    By November 1980

    Markings Applied: OH

    14 June 1991

    Struck off Strength/Charge from the 309th Aerospace Maintenance and Regeneration Center (AMARC).

    4 April 1997

    To National, Kolb Road, Tucson, AZ.

    1997

    Scrapped.
